Neither fornicators, nor idolaters, nor adulterers, nor [ b]homosexuals, nor [ c]sodomites, 10 nor thieves, nor covetous, nor drunkards, nor revilers, nor extortioners will inherit the kingdom of God. 11 And such were some of you.Wesley's Notes for 1 Corinthians 6:10. 6:8 Nay, ye do wrong - Openly. And defraud - Privately. O how powerfully did the mystery of iniquity already work! 6:9 Idolatry is here placed between fornication and adultery, because they generally accompanied it. Nor the effeminate - Who live in an easy, indolent way; taking up no cross, enduring no hardship.1 Corinthians 6:9-10King James Version. 9 Know ye not that the unrighteous shall not inherit the kingdom of God? 1 Corinthians 6:9-10 KJV. Know ye not that the unrighteous shall not inherit the kingdom of God? Be not deceived: neither fornicators, nor idolaters, nor adulterers, nor effeminate, nor abusers of themselves with mankind, nor thieves, nor covetous, nor drunkards, nor revilers, nor extortioners, shall inherit the kingdom of God. Cautions against going to law in heathen courts. (1-8) Sins which, if lived and died in, shut out from the kingdom of God. (9-11) Our bodies, which are the members of Christ, and temples of the Holy Ghost, must not be defiled. (12-20)1-8 Christians should not contend with one another, for they are brethren.…
